Let's go over a couple of definitions first. You hear it all
the time "metabolism", but what it is? Its the process of
converting food into energy (movement and heat). Metabolism
happens in your muscles and organs and the result of it is what
we commonly refer to as "burning calories". Metabolism is
essentially the speed at which your bodies motor is running.

Then there is this term of "basal metabolism". "Basal
metabolism" is the metabolic rate or caloric expenditure needed
to maintain basal body functions such as your heart beating,
breathing, muscle tone, etc. It's how fast your "motor" is
running when your still in a reclines position or sleeping.
Basal metabolism accounts for about 75% of the calories you
expend on a daily basis! There is a simple formula for this and
I will go over that in another article.

If I eat all day I will get fat...A little known fact is, if
you starve yourself, you are going to slow down your metabolism.
Contrary to popular belief is you need to eat 300-400 calories
meals through the day. Eat these smaller metabolism booster
meals four to six times per day.

I just have a slow metabolism...this could be true. If you
start eating these using these foods in your recipes, cooking
and snacking and you are not losing weight, then you should
probably go and have your thyroid checked out. There might be
something wrong.

Small snacks can also help keep your body from running out of
fuel, preventing those 3 p.m. office blahs. "When you restrict
the number of calories your body has for fuel, your metabolic
rate can drop temporarily," says Susan Roberts, Ph.D., chief of
the energy-metabolism laboratory at Tufts University in Boston.
That makes it easier to pack on the pounds and harder to burn
them off again.

Here is how and why these super foods increase metabolic rate.

Each of these healthy foods and weight loss boosters will keep
you full longer on less calories

Water rich fresh fruits, vegetables and soup will dilute the
calories in your foods, so you can eat more and not overdue the
calories

High fiber whole grains, fruits and nutritious veggies keep the
digestive system on track as well as steady the insulin levels,
which is going to prevent fat storage
